The historic Heritage Hall
(historically referenced to as the Civic Auditorium, Ardmore Auditorium or
Convention Hall) is located at 220 W. Broadway, Ardmore, Oklahoma.

| The graphic to the right was adopted as the logo of the Heritage Hall. The double "H" is for
the namesake. The bar surrounds are a scaled replica of the hand
rails that are installed in the Lobby at the ticketing counters. |

| Description: |
Auditorium with stage and arena floor with fixed raised
seating around the arena floor and viewing the stage. Situated in
award winning Historic Downtown Main Street. WPA historic
documentation in lobby areas with Art Deco atmosphere. Air
conditioned and modern restroom facilities. |
| Seating: |
1080 fixed, 1800 maximum capacity. |
| Size: |
Floor area approximately 4500 square feet, stage 1800
square feet. |
